Latest Patents
Doerig holds a significant patent for a measuring instrument with a connecting coupling. This patented design includes a measuring element and a sealing fitting that is structured in a two-part configuration. This innovation aims to provide structural improvements to achieve permanent tightness, particularly beneficial in environments characterized by vibration and temperature fluctuations.
